This book places nutrition study within a conceptual framework that allows professionals and lay readers alike to identify the linkages that exist among seemingly disparate phenomena (energy, environment, food, nutrition, and health). It views nutrition from an ecological perspective.

Critical Food Issues of the Eighties: Pergamon Policy Studies — 39 focuses on the problems of the food industry, including food and nutrition policies and impact of regulation on food and agricultural productivity and agricultural chemicals. The selection first discusses the preoccupation with food safety, as well as advances in agricultural productivity and food processing; cultural and social changes affecting the food industry; and diet-related health concerns. The book then takes a look at food price inflation, as well as price trends in the food systems, economic efficiency in the food system, imported foods, and profitability. The text reviews changing food policies and national nutrition goals. Concerns include expanded constituency and components of food policies; conquering nutrition deficiency diseases; nutrient food disclosure; and difficulty of identifying nutrient usage or food group needs. The selection also tackles the effects of government policies on technological innovation in the food industry; assessment of future technological advances in agriculture and their impact on the regulatory environment; and changing attitudes and lifestyle shaping food technology in the 1980s. The book is a vital source of data for readers interested in the issues of the food industry in the 1980s.

Abstract: A review of 20 years of research that has formed the scientific basis of clinical nutrition provides information necessary for setting future directions in nutrition research. The most important areas of clinical nutrition research are identified. A wide range of interdisciplinary studies examining the effects of nutrition in health and disease have established the interrelations among nutritional, behavioral, and biomedical factors. This assessment of the state-of-the-art of nutrition research includes a summary of federal agency nutrition programs funded and administered by NIH, FDA, DOD, and USDA. The opinions and conclusions of consumer, and scientific panels address specific nutrition issues, including clinical nutrition. Recommendations for achieving goals in nutrition research and training, national policy, and nutrition education are discussed. (nm).

Abstract: Proceedings of the Western Hemisphere Nutrition Congress reflect analysis of the current state of scientificknowledge, methods used to determine the needs of individuals and populations, and procedures for establishingnational policies and priorities for nutrition intervention programs. General topics include methods of assessing food intake and nutritional status; the effect of diet on immunosuppression; and disease and nutrition intervention through supplementary feeding programs. A discussion of nutrition's relationship to health and disease includes discussions of anemia, zinc and copper, cardiovascular disease, and infant malnutrition. A review of nutritional status in the Western hemisphere focuses on Canada, the US, and Central and South America. Technology's role in improving the food supply and national nutrition policies ofWestern countries also is covered. (ds).

Abstract: The 1977 Food and Agriculture Act designated the Department of Agriculture as the lead agency for the conduct of human nutrition research. It specifies five priority areas for basic and applied research and nutrition education research : (1) human nutrition requirements; (2) composition of foods and the effects of agricultural practices, handling, processing and cooking on nutrients; (3) surveillance of nutritional benefits to participate in USDA programs; (4) factors affecting consumer food preferences and eating habits and (5) development of techniques and equipment to assist consumers in selecting food to provide a nutritionally balanced diet. The comprehensive plan for delivery of human nutrition research and services is a plan with a basic statement of purpose and priorities which describes current programs for meeting the priorities and concludes with a discussion of future goals and implementation plans.

Abstract: Child nutrition programs have been increasingly supported by the federal government, but the recent concerns about inflation and government expenditures have necessitated a thorough program review, including costs, purposes, nutritional effectiveness, resource allocation and available alternatives. There are currently 10 programs under scrutiny, including WIC, breakfast, lunch and summer meal programs, commodity supplements and nutrition education, which are funded by reimbursements as if they were entitlements. Existing policies at state, local, and federal levels are examined as well as the anticipated impact of changing policy and funding. Each program is analyzed according to target population, type of benefit, number of participants, and costs. The commodity program is examined from 2 aspects: the impact of expenditures on agriculture and the impact of food programs on child health. These analyses are supported with statistical data on diet analysis, technical tables and food distribution authorization legislation.

Abstract: Proceedings of a meeting of the American College of Nutrition focus on important nutrition issues in infant and child health. A discussion of malnutrition reviews the biochemical, physiological and morphological effects of diarrhea on the intestine. Discussion of the opposite problem of overnutrition covers the energetic basis of obesity, serum lipids and their relation to diet, and body composition in adolescence. A history of vitamin D begins with the identification of vitamin D deficiency as a cause of rickets and continues to the discovery of its metabolic pathways. A comprehensive review of human milk includes its nutritional composition and its role in preventing infection. The use of stable isotopes in the study of protein metabolism is described. (ds).

Public concern about the safety and healthfulness of the food supply grew markedly during the 1980s. Numerous government, academic, interest group, and media reports questioning the adequacy of the food safety regulatory system formed the basis for this increase in concern. While public concern focused most directly on pesticide residues in food, scientists emphasized the risks of illness associated with microbiological contamination of food. Much additional attention was focused on the food supply as a result of the striking consensus on dietary recommendations that emerged in the late 1980s based on increased scientific knowledge of linkages between diet and health. Relatively little research on the economic aspects of food safety and nutrition issues had been conducted up to the mid-1980s. These aspects are complex. On the consumer demand side, they include consumers' perceptions of the risks associated with particular food products, how demographic characteristics influence consumers' processing of risk information and subsequent changes in food demand behavior, and the monetary value consumers might place on changes in the risk profiles of products. The economic benefits and costs associated with current food consumption patterns are a major determinant of demand for improved food safety and dietary change through government regulation. While a more complete picture of risks, benefits, and costs has been emerging recently, much is yet unknown.
